Design and Build Quality
The Fuers 16-channel DVR unit typically sports a standard, professional black metal casing common to surveillance equipment. While not groundbreaking in aesthetics, its robust build is designed to sit securely in a server cabinet or on a shelf. The front panel usually features status indicators, and the rear panel is packed with the necessary ports: 16 BNC ports for analog/AHD/TVI/CVI cameras, HDMI and VGA outputs for local monitor connection, USB ports for mouse and backup, an Ethernet port for network connectivity, and the power input.
The inclusion of a 2TB Hard Disk Drive (HDD) pre-installed is a significant value-add, ensuring the system is operational for continuous 24/7 recording immediately after setup, without the need for an immediate additional purchase.
Performance: The 6-in-1 Hybrid Edge
The main selling point of this Fuers DVR is its Hybrid 6-in-1 capability. This exceptional compatibility allows it to connect and manage cameras utilizing six different technologies: AHD, TVI, CVI, CVBS (traditional analog), IP, and XVI.
Maximum Versatility: This feature is a game-changer for users who are upgrading an older system or have a mix of camera types. You can gradually replace older, low-resolution cameras with new 5MP ones without having to scrap the entire system.
5MP HD Recording: The DVR supports recording at up to 5MP (2592P) resolution. This high resolution is critical for capturing fine details, like license plates or facial features, which is crucial for evidence collection. While some user reviews of Fuers cameras suggest mixed quality (sometimes appearing 'grainy'), the DVR unit itself supports the higher resolution, meaning performance will ultimately depend on the quality of the connected cameras.
Storage Efficiency and Longevity (H.265+)
Modern security systems generate massive amounts of data. The H.265+ video compression technology in the Fuers DVR addresses this challenge head-on. By significantly improving the compression ratio compared to the older H.264 standard, H.265+ can save up to 80% of storage space.
For the end-user, this translates directly into longer recording times on the pre-installed 2TB HDD. Furthermore, it lessens the required network bandwidth for remote viewing, leading to faster and smoother streaming with reduced latency, especially when viewing multiple high-resolution feeds simultaneously.
Smart Surveillance: Human Detection
A standout feature is the Human Detection (AI) capability. Traditional motion detection is notoriously unreliable, often sending push notifications for trivial events like a cat walking by, leaves blowing, or even changes in lighting.
The Fuers system’s intelligent Human Detection algorithm is designed to filter out these common false alarms, sending alerts only when a human figure is detected in the frame. This ensures that users are notified of actual potential security threats, minimizing alert fatigue and making the remote monitoring process much more effective and reliable.
Ease of Use and Remote Access
Setting up the DVR for local recording is straightforward—simply connect the cameras, a monitor via HDMI/VGA, and a mouse.
For remote access, the Fuers system utilizes the popular icSee App (available for iOS and Android) and VMS Client software for PCs. After connecting the DVR to a router via Ethernet, users can easily scan a QR code to link the device. This provides the ability to:
View live feeds from all 16 channels.
Playback recorded footage remotely.
Receive push notifications instantly upon human detection.
Crucially, the DVR allows local 24/7 recording even without an internet connection, with the internet only required for remote viewing and alerts—a key benefit for maintaining security even during network outages.
